Thank you ,everyone, for your good wishes.  I had a huge response to my
post regarding a reaction to this year's flu shot.  More than half the
responders had no reaction; most of them had never had a reaction.
Almost all of the other responders had a reaction involving sore arms,
fever, etc. but less than a dozen people said they had stomach problems.
Those that did have a stomach reaction, however, had the same nausea
problems I did, some lasting for quite some time.  Ten people
recommended that those with celiac disease never get flu shots, but my
doctor feels differently.
Several people wondered if I'm allergic to eggs, but I'm not.  I should
say that I also have lupus and this may have some bearing, but I can't
figure out what.
I'm still nauseated after five days, but not as much.  There is still a
four-inch welt, but it's not as hot as it was and I have no fever.  I'm
definitely on the uphill slope.
